Redirection based on pool member
Fist of all apologize for my lack of knowledge. I need to redirect to different URL based on pool member balanced (it's not possible to do it on server side). For example:

If you really did mean redirect, and not rewrite, this might do the trick (not tested):
when LB_SELECTED { if { [IP::addr [LB::server addr] equals 192.168.1.1] } { HTTP::respond 302 Location "https://www.hostname1.com/extension" } else { HTTP::respond 302 Location "https://www.hostname2.com/extension" } }Seems like a funny thing to do, but who am I to judge without knowing the background. 🙂
Change to 301 from 302 if you want to make the redirect permanent.

And if you wanted to do a rewrite this should do the trick (still not tested):
when LB_SELECTED { HTTP::uri "/extension" if { [IP::addr [LB::server addr] equals 192.168.1.1] } { HTTP::host "www.hostname1.com" } else { HTTP::host "www.hostname2.com" } }/Patrik
